Gur pedi prices rose by Rs 100 per quintal at the wholesale gur (Jaggery) market in the national capital today following paucity of stocks amid speculative buying.
Muradnagar gur market also showed a rise of Rs 100 per quintal in gur Dhayya prices on scarcity of stocks.
Elsewhere, other gur varieties were well maintained at previous levels in the absence of worthwhile activity.

Marketmen said paucity of stocks on tight supplies against increased offtake by stockists and retailers, largely pushed up gur Pedi prices in Delhi and Dhayya prices in Muradnagar.
In Delhi, gur pedi prices were higher by Rs 100 each to end at Rs 3,100-3,200 per quintal.
At Muradnagar gur Dhayya prices traded higher by Rs 100 to settle the day at Rs 2,800-2,850 per quintal.
Following are today's rates (in Rs per quintal):
Gur chakku Rs 2,900-3,000, pedi Rs 3,100-3,200, dhayya Rs 3,200-3,300 and shakkar Rs 3,300-3,400.
Muzaffarnagar: Rasket Rs 2,400-2,450, chakku Rs 2,625- 2,950, khurpa Rs 2,600-2,650 and Ladoo Rs 2,850-2,950.
Muradnagar: Pedi Rs 2,650-2750 and dhayya Rs 2,800-2,850.
